Who lives here β€” American Community Survey 5-year estimates (2024), VA-09. Source.

CategoryMetricValue
PeoplePopulation780,117
PeopleMedian age44
IncomeMedian household income$58,380
IncomePer-capita income$34,480
IncomeIn poverty16.3%
IncomeUnemployed3.8%
IncomeGini inequality index0.480
RaceWhite alone87.4%
RaceBlack alone5.6%
RaceAsian alone1.6%
RaceHispanic or Latino3.3%
RaceTwo or more races3.8%
OriginForeign-born3.3%
LanguageSpeaks English only at home95.2%
LanguageSpeaks Spanish at home2.3%
EducationHigh school or higher58.6%
EducationBachelor's or higher23.9%
EducationAdvanced degree9.5%
HouseholdFamily households62.8%
HouseholdAvg household size2.34
HouseholdNever married (15+)29.4%
HousingMedian home value$180,900
HousingMedian gross rent$860
HousingSingle-family detached70.0%
HousingBuilt before 19405.8%
HousingOvercrowded (>1 per room)1.4%
HousingVacant units17.1%
ServiceVeterans (18+)6.8%
HealthWith a disability19.5%
ConnectivityHouseholds with broadband83.3%
ConnectivityHouseholds with no internet13.6%
CommuteDrove alone78.2%
CommutePublic transit0.6%
CommuteWorked from home9.7%
